Awake Ny x Air Jordan 6 Marks the Silhouette's 35th Anniversary

The Awake NY x Air Jordan 6 celebrates the 35th anniversary of the iconic basketball silhouette through a collaboration inspired by New York's bootleg fashion culture. Designed with founder Angelo Baque, the sneaker combines exaggerated colour blocking, reworked branding and exposed stitching with premium materials including Saffiano leather, Midnight Navy and Light Blue leather panels, Game Royal nubuck, Sail accents and Infrared 23 details. Classic Air Jordan 6 features, such as the lace pocket, dual lace toggles and visible Nike Air cushioning, remain intact while incorporating Awake NY branding throughout the design.

The collaboration extends beyond footwear with a coordinated apparel collection featuring a co-branded tracksuit, polo shirt and additional ready-to-wear pieces designed to complement the sneaker. Blending luxury materials with references to New York street culture, the capsule explores the contrast between elevated craftsmanship and bootleg-inspired aesthetics.
